Overview
The history of tools is a testament to human ingenuity, with each innovation building upon the last to shape the world we live in today. From the early stone tools crafted by Homo habilis around 2.6 million years ago, to the sophisticated software and machines of the modern era, tools have played a crucial role in driving human progress. The development of tools has been marked by significant milestones, including the invention of the wheel around 4000 BCE, the introduction of the printing press in 1450 CE, and the emergence of the internet in the late 20th century. Today, tools continue to evolve at a rapid pace, with advancements in artificial intelligence, robotics, and biotechnology poised to revolutionize numerous aspects of our lives. As we look to the future, it is clear that tools will remain a vital component of human innovation, with the potential to address some of the world's most pressing challenges.
